Texture, Depth, and a Touch of Thread

The beauty of embroidery lies in the method. The right stitch can turn a simple idea into something extraordinary. We choose our techniques based on what will work best for the material, the design, and the purpose of the piece.

Our embroidery services in Orangeburg, NY, include some of the methods, including:

  • Satin Stitch – Smooth, continuous lines that give letters and shapes a bold, polished look.
  • Fill Stitch – Dense coverage for solid designs that hold their presence.
  • Chain Stitch – Looped thread that adds character and a handmade feel.
  • Appliqué Method – Fabric pieces sewn into a design for added depth and variety.
  • 3D Puff Embroidery – Foam underlay that lifts the thread for a striking, raised effect.

Various patterns impart a sense of boldness, texture, and dimension that is impossible to overlook. This variation lets us make embroidery that looks and feels great, whether it’s a single word on a cap or a big, intricate insignia on a garment.

How small can embroidery details be?

Letters have to be at least 1/4 inch tall, with enough space for threads to keep shapes clear.
